In this video I go over part 2 of the example which I covered in my last video on modifying the Lotka-Volterra equations for predator-prey systems by using a logistic model growth rate for the prey population. In that part I went over the equilibrium solutions, and in this part I take a look at a phase trajectory of the predator-prey, or wolf-rabbit, populations. I also sketch the possible graph of the populations of each species through time, which shows how the populations fluctuate until they stabilize at a specific level.
